By doing so, they sustain life on Earth. … WebMar 10, 2024 · The ylws mutant was impaired in chloroplast ribosome biogenesis and chloroplast development under low temperature conditions. The ylws mutation causes defects in splicing of atpF, ndhA, rpl2, and rps12, and editing of ndhA, ndhB and rps14 transcripts. YLWS directly binds to specific sites in the atpF, ndhA, and rpl2 pre-mRNAs.
